Yes, absolutely, conceiving with PCOS is very possible! It might just take a bit more planning and medical support. Tracking your cycle with apps can still be helpful, but also consider using ovulation predictor kits as your ovulation might be irregular. Your gynac will likely discuss lifestyle changes and possibly medications like metformin or ovulation inducers. Stay positive and follow your doctor's advice carefully.
